Let’s Play

Temmi, Eddie, Beth, Carolyn, Kim, Sharon, Beverly, Jamie … all of us together.

We played. We laughed. We argued. But, most of all, we loved.

A few years ago, I encountered a couple of little girls who had not seen each other in a while. They squealed with delight at their reunion. As they hugged, one said, “We need to play!”

As beautiful as that moment was, it made me sad. I no longer played. Would I still know how?

The passing of one of our gang sparked lots of memories, like when we would go “riding bikes around the block.” It was fun. It was adventurous because we would try to outdo each other with wheelies. The speed races were epic.

We celebrated every birthday with a party. We put lighting bugs in a jar, flew June bugs on a string, and watched caterpillars break through the cocoons to become butterflies. We devoured fresh watermelon with salt. Took turns cranking the ice cream maker. And we had fun.

It has been many years, decades, since we were all together. We have all moved in different directions and faced many challenges along the way. But we all have something in common that has helped us through our journeys.

We are fortunate to have been given a good foundation for life. We are fortunate to have been together. We are fortunate to have made it this far.

Let’s go back to celebrating our birthdays and enjoying the joys of getting drenched in watermelon juice. We have made it this far because we have been blessed with our friends along the way.

Who wants to go ride bikes?
